IISc AI Image Annotation Job Description:

As an AI Image Annotation Intern at IISc, you’ll contribute to creating India’s first comprehensive traffic dataset for ML models. Your work will directly impact AI solutions designed for diverse Indian road conditions.

SPONSORED

Key Responsibilities in AI Annotation Internship:

  • Annotate traffic images identifying vehicles, pedestrians, and road infrastructure.
  • Collaborate with AI researchers to refine annotation guidelines.
  • Participate in quality assurance checks for dataset accuracy.
  • Document annotation processes and challenges.
  • Attend weekly progress reviews with project teams.

What exactly does Indian Institute of Science (IISc) do?

Established in 1909, IISc Bangalore is India’s premier institution for scientific research and education. Ranked #1 in India by NIRF 2023, IISc leads cutting-edge research across 40+ departments.
